Spinalonga is a small island on the northeastern coast of Crete, right in front of the exclusive seaside resort of Elounda, and not far from the city of Agios Nikolaos. However, the islet is only 170 metres from Kolokytha and the water is shallow, so perhaps the Venetians did indeed carry out this project to form an impregnable island fortress. What you see from the coast are the remains of a 16th-century Venetian fortress, but what makes Spinalonga unique are the ruined houses and buildings of the settlement that was from 1903-1957 Greeces official leper colony. Today the name Spinalonga is only applied to the islet, but the Venetians used it to include the large peninsula of Nissi or Kolokytha, which is connected to Elounda by a narrow isthmus. The tiny, teardrop-shaped island of Spinalonga, just off the southern coast of Cretes Lassithi region, wasnt always on the tourist map. Sail to this rocky island, and explore the streets, houses, and ruined Venetian fortifications where lepers were confined from 1903 to 1957.
